黑狐家游戏

一个典型的数据仓库系统的组成,深入解析,一个典型数据仓库系统的五大核心组成部分

欧气 0 0

本文目录导读:

  1. 数据源
  2. 数据仓库模型
  3. 数据存储与管理
  4. 数据访问与查询
  5. 数据仓库安全与运维

随着信息技术的飞速发展,数据仓库作为企业信息化建设的重要基础,已经成为企业竞争力和管理水平的象征,一个典型的数据仓库系统,通常由以下五个核心组成部分构成:

数据源

数据源是数据仓库系统的基石,它包括企业内部和外部的各种数据来源,内部数据源主要是指企业各个业务系统产生的业务数据,如ERP、CRM、SCM等;外部数据源则包括行业数据、竞争对手数据、市场数据等,数据源的质量直接影响到数据仓库的数据质量,对数据源进行合理的选择和整合至关重要。

一个典型的数据仓库系统的组成,深入解析,一个典型数据仓库系统的五大核心组成部分

图片来源于网络,如有侵权联系删除

1、数据源分类

(1)内部数据源:包括企业各个业务系统产生的业务数据,如ERP、CRM、SCM等。

(2)外部数据源:包括行业数据、竞争对手数据、市场数据等。

2、数据源整合

(1)数据集成:通过数据集成技术,将来自不同数据源的数据进行统一格式转换和整合。

(2)数据清洗:对数据源中的数据进行清洗,包括去除重复数据、填补缺失值、修正错误数据等。

数据仓库模型

数据仓库模型是数据仓库系统的核心,它决定了数据仓库的数据结构、数据存储方式以及数据访问方式,一个典型的数据仓库模型包括以下几种:

1、星型模型(Star Schema):以事实表为中心,将维度表连接到事实表,形成星型结构。

一个典型的数据仓库系统的组成,深入解析,一个典型数据仓库系统的五大核心组成部分

图片来源于网络,如有侵权联系删除

2、雪花模型(Snowflake Schema):在星型模型的基础上,对维度表进行进一步细化,形成雪花结构。

3、星座模型(Federated Schema):将多个数据仓库模型进行整合,形成一个虚拟的数据仓库模型。

数据存储与管理

数据存储与管理是数据仓库系统的核心环节,它包括数据的存储、备份、恢复、优化等,以下是数据存储与管理的主要技术:

1、数据存储技术:如关系型数据库、NoSQL数据库、分布式数据库等。

2、数据备份与恢复:采用定期备份、增量备份、全量备份等技术,确保数据安全。

3、数据优化:通过索引、分区、物化视图等技术,提高数据查询性能。

数据访问与查询

数据访问与查询是数据仓库系统的关键环节,它包括数据检索、数据挖掘、报表生成等,以下是数据访问与查询的主要技术:

1、数据检索:通过SQL、MDX等查询语言,实现对数据仓库数据的检索。

一个典型的数据仓库系统的组成,深入解析,一个典型数据仓库系统的五大核心组成部分

图片来源于网络,如有侵权联系删除

2、数据挖掘:利用数据挖掘技术,从数据中挖掘有价值的信息。

3、报表生成:通过报表工具,生成各类统计报表、分析报告等。

数据仓库安全与运维

数据仓库安全与运维是保障数据仓库系统稳定运行的重要环节,以下是数据仓库安全与运维的主要内容:

1、数据安全:通过权限控制、加密、审计等技术,确保数据安全。

2、系统运维:包括系统监控、故障排除、性能优化等。

一个典型的数据仓库系统由数据源、数据仓库模型、数据存储与管理、数据访问与查询、数据仓库安全与运维五个核心组成部分构成,只有全面、深入地了解这些组成部分,才能构建一个高效、稳定、安全的数据仓库系统,为企业提供有力支持。

标签: #一个典型的数据仓库系统通常包含哪几个组成部分

黑狐家游戏
  • 评论列表

留言评论